开发一款APP的成本差异巨大,从几万元到数百万元不等。许多企业因对开发流程和成本构成不清晰,导致预算超支或项目烂尾。本文结合行业实战经验,总结影响成本的核心因素、报价参考及避坑技巧,帮助企业精准规划预算。
一、影响APP开发成本的六大核心因素
1、功能复杂度
基础功能(如用户登录、支付接口)占总成本的30%-50%;
高级功能(如即时通讯、AI算法、直播系统)可能使成本翻倍甚至更高。
示例:
简单工具类APP(如天气查询):5万-15万元;
社交类APP(含聊天、直播):80万-200万元起。
2、开发模式选择
原生开发(iOS+Android双端):性能优但成本高,适合复杂应用;
混合开发(H5嵌套):成本降低30%,适合内容展示型APP;
跨平台开发(如Flutter):节省40%成本,但需测试兼容性。
3、设计要求
标准化模板设计费用约1-3万元;
高定制化UI/UX设计(动效、品牌化视觉)需5万元以上。
4、开发团队背景
一线城市团队人均日薪800-1500元;
远程或海外团队(如东欧、印度)可降本50%,但需承担沟通风险。
5、后期运维成本
年均维护费约为初期开发费的15%-20%,包括BUG修复、系统升级;
用户量超过1万时,服务器年成本约2-5万元。
6、第三方服务费用
支付接口(如支付宝、微信支付):年费0.5万-2万元;
地图API(如高德、Google Maps):按调用次数收费,年均1万-3万元。
二、2025年典型APP开发成本参考
基础工具类APP(如计算器、记事本):功能单一,开发周期1-2个月,成本5万-15万元。
中小型电商APP(商品展示+购物车+支付):开发周期3-4个月,成本15万-30万元。
O2O服务APP(预约+定位+在线支付):开发周期4-6个月,成本30万-60万元。
社交/直播APP(即时通讯+视频流):开发周期6-12个月,成本80万-200万元起。
企业内部管理系统(如CRM、ERP):开发周期3-5个月,成本20万-50万元。
三、企业避坑指南:4大常见陷阱与对策
1、需求模糊导致成本激增
陷阱:前期需求不明确,开发中频繁变更功能。
对策:采用MVP模式,优先开发核心功能,签订合同时明确“需求冻结期”。
2、低价签约后隐性加价
陷阱:外包公司以低价吸引客户,后期通过“需求变更”追加费用。
对策:要求拆分报价单,确认功能模块的单价和验收标准。
3、技术选型不合理
陷阱:使用冷门技术栈,导致后期维护困难、成本飙升。
对策:选择主流框架(如Android用Kotlin、iOS用Swift)。
4、忽视运维成本
陷阱:未预留维护预算,上线后系统崩溃或无法升级。
对策:要求开发方提供至少1年免费运维支持,并提前规划服务器费用。
四、3大实战技巧控制成本
1、精准需求文档(PRD)
使用Axure/墨刀制作可视化原型,减少沟通偏差;
标注“核心功能”和“扩展功能”,分阶段开发。
2、灵活选择开发模式
初期用跨平台框架(如Flutter)快速验证市场,用户增长后再迭代原生功能。
3、优化合作方式
选择固定总价合同锁定预算,或按模块付费控制风险;
关键岗位(如产品经理)自聘,其余外包降低成本。
五、常见问题解答
1、“自建团队还是外包更划算?”
短期项目选外包(节省人力及办公成本);长期产品建议自建团队。
2、“相同功能报价为何差异大?”
代码质量(是否可扩展)、团队资质(全职或兼职)、售后服务(是否含运维)是主因。
3、“如何验证报价合理性?”
横向对比3-5家公司的拆分报价(如后端、UI、测试各占比例),警惕过低或过高方案。
APP成本评估需平衡功能、质量与预算。若需精准测算,
北京一网天行科技有限公司提供免费成本评估服务,基于行业数据库与AI工具,1个工作日内输出详细报价清单,助您规避风险,高效启动项目!
如需进一步了解垂直行业(如:医疗、教育、党建、商协会)的成本差异,或获取《APP项目开发功能清单》,欢迎随时咨询!